While looking at it, bamboo scaffolding may appear fragile, but it’s really a time-proven technique that goes back a thousand years, and is still widely considered today.
In Hong Kong, bamboo scaffolding is used as the primary method to build skyscrapers, which at first glance, seems a bit risky. However, compared to iron rods that we use here in Warwickshire, bamboo rods are cheaper, faster to build, and easier to transport. Despite their appearance, bamboo rods are actually safer, as they are much lighter than iron rods and cause less damage if they fall.
To build with bamboo, which can be as huge as The Shard in London, it only requires three things: Bamboo Rods, Scissors, and string. Scaffolders often set up the scaffold structure in the middle of the night, eight hours at a time.
Though the most common to see these at construction sites across the city, bamboo scaffolding has also been used to create temporary Cantonese opera theatres and church halls, most notably for the ‘Yu Lan Ghost Festival’
In 2000, several scaffolders from Hong Kong were invited to Berlin, Germany to build a work of art using bamboo scaffolding. According to German scaffolders, they were sceptical about the strength of the structure. But when the structure was all done, people of Berlin were amazed and blown away over the strength. The bamboo installation later won an award from the Hong Kong institute of Architects.
